Abstract

We consider fourth order elliptic systems in divergence form with greatly discontinuous coefficients in a nonsmooth domain. Our domain is composed of a finite number of disjoint subdomains with (δ,R)-Reifenberg flat boundaries, and the coefficients, which are allowed to have great discontinuity across the boundaries of subdomains, have small BMO semi-norms on each subdomain. Our main result is deriving the global W2,p (1<p<∞) regularity, with the estimates independent of the distance between the subdomains.
